What it is
Cred Protocol is an on-chain reputation and credit analytics infrastructure layer for Web3. It transforms raw blockchain activity into structured, risk-weighted intelligence that developers and protocols can use in real time.
At its core, Cred provides APIs and scoring models that help protocols, lenders, marketplaces, and AI agents assess identity strength, behavioral reputation, and counterparty risk across blockchain networks.
Core products include:
- On-chain credit scoring for wallets and entities
- A Sybil Detection API to identify bot clusters and coordinated wallet behavior
- Reputation reports based on transaction history, counterparty diversity, gas patterns, wallet age, identity attestations, and funding source clustering
- Risk analytics tooling for DeFi lenders, underwriters, marketplaces, and agent ecosystems
Cred Protocol has already served 350,000+ on-chain credit score requests and analyzed 200M+ wallet addresses across EVM chains. Its Sybil Detection API returns probabilistic bot risk scores from 0–100, complete with behavioral breakdowns. Identity attestations can be weighted up to 25% in scoring models, prioritizing credentials that are costly to fake.
The mission is to build the foundational trust layer for the on-chain economy, enabling undercollateralized lending, risk-based pricing, sybil-resistant incentive systems, and secure agent-to-agent commerce.
Why it matters
Web3 has unlocked programmable assets and permissionless infrastructure. What it has not yet unlocked at scale is portable, quantitative reputation.
Today, most DeFi systems rely on overcollateralization because counterparty risk is difficult to measure. Airdrops and incentive campaigns are frequently farmed by coordinated bot networks. AI agent marketplaces cannot reliably distinguish between high-quality participants and malicious actors.
Cred Protocol addresses these challenges by quantifying:
- Identity strength
- Behavioral consistency
- Funding relationships
- Counterparty diversity
- Transaction history patterns
This enables applications to move from blunt heuristics and static allowlists to dynamic, risk-adjusted decision making.

Why on SKALE
Cred Protocol selected SKALE to support high-frequency, latency-sensitive reputation analytics at scale.
SKALE’s BITE-enabled privacy provides a foundation for secure, verifiable execution while protecting sensitive data flows and analytics logic. For a protocol operating at the intersection of identity and behavioral risk scoring, privacy-preserving infrastructure is essential.
Zero gas fees are critical for reputation infrastructure. Risk checks, attestations, and scoring updates can occur frequently across applications. On fee-based networks, costs accumulate quickly and limit adoption. SKALE’s zero gas architecture enables frictionless reputation queries without economic overhead.
Instant finality ensures that scoring updates and risk signals are confirmed immediately. Lending protocols, marketplaces, and agent ecosystems can act on reputation data in real time without waiting for probabilistic settlement.
